There is going to be an AMHR/Pinto santioned show on May 24 & 25 in Corunna at Shiawassee Fairgrounds. It will have AMHR classes and Pinto classes in the show bill. It is not posted on the MSPBO website yet. Will let you know if I get any more information.

The showbill is not on the MSPBO website yet. The showbill that is on there is for Saturday and Sunday and is for PINTO registered miniatures only. The AMHR/Pinto showbill will be posted at a later date. This show will be held on Sunday & Monday and will have a normal AMHR santioned show amount of classes, plus pinto classes also.

It looks like if you have pinto minis in Michigan this is a GOOD association to use to get your feet wet. Class fees 15.00 each you can show from your trailer and they offer halter, color, showmanship, jumping, trail and 2 height divisions for driving and 2 other group driving classes. AND if they add in the AMHR show on Monday BONUS. Practice on Saturday rest a day and Show AMHR Monday. NEAT!
